Every year, many Ghanaians apply for visas to the United States. Sadly, a large number are refused under 214(b) (not proving strong ties) or 212(a) (inadmissibility or misrepresentation).

A refusal does not always mean the end of your journey. With the right legal support, you may be able to file an appeal, motion, or re-application to increase your chances of success.


 Common Reasons for USA Visa Refusal in Ghana

  • Not proving strong family or financial ties in Ghana
  • Missing or weak supporting documents
  • Errors in completing the DS-160 or forms
  • Past immigration breaches
  • Misrepresentation (intentional or unintentional)
